This immaculate semi-detached house offers a fantastic opportunity for families seeking a comfortable and versatile home in a sought-after location. Boasting three bedrooms, it provides ample space for modern living. The first bedroom features built-in wardrobes and generous proportions, while the second is a spacious double, and the third is a well-sized single bedroom, suitable for a child or home office.
The open-plan reception room is bright and inviting, benefiting from large windows and direct access to the south-facing garden, offering an ideal space for both entertaining and relaxation. Adjacent to the living and dining area is an extended kitchen, fitted with sleek granite countertops and bathed in natural light, making it a pleasant environment for meal preparation.
Additional highlights include a downstairs WC, a practical utility room that can also serve as office space, and a family bathroom equipped with a shower over the bath. Outside, the property enjoys its own driveway and garage, providing convenient off-street parking and storage solutions.
The property is conveniently situated close to public transport links and nearby parks, ensuring easy access to daily amenities and green open spaces. This well-presented family home combines practical features with a desirable setting, making it an appealing choice for those looking to settle in a vibrant community.
